Output 846876acc3722508bbce26c69ecb128d803ea3086b1f7e157c8fea1ccc3cd30c:0

value
2993588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 323a4c088eb68e1e2f572a19d95931aaf91ecb4e OP_EQUAL
address
36GbYgXHXS35r8yhQ8TaVwHLTbfpj7xgN4
transaction
846876acc3722508bbce26c69ecb128d803ea3086b1f7e157c8fea1ccc3cd30c
confirmations
389297
spent
true